"""Official managed-update source selection and bounded git network calls."""
from __future__ import annotations
import os
import re
import subprocess
from typing import Callable, List, Optional, Tuple
FETCH_TIMEOUT_RC = 124
MANAGED_TAG_NAMESPACE = "refs/ouroboros-managed/tags"
_RELEASE_TAG_RE = re.compile(r"^v(\d+)\.(\d+)\.(\d+)$")
def official_ref_has_constitution(
ref: str, *, repo_dir: os.PathLike[str] | str | None = None
) -> bool:
"""Whether *ref* contains the non-empty regular ``BIBLE.md`` required by P4."""
if repo_dir is None:
from supervisor import git_ops as _g
repo_dir = _g.REPO_DIR
try:
result = subprocess.run(
["git", "ls-tree", "-l", ref, "--", "BIBLE.md"],
cwd=str(repo_dir),
capture_output=True,
text=True,
check=False,
)
except OSError:
return False
fields = (result.stdout or "").strip().split(maxsplit=4)
return bool(
result.returncode == 0
and len(fields) == 5
and fields[0] in {"100644", "100755"}
and fields[1] == "blob"
and fields[3].isdigit()
and int(fields[3]) > 0
and fields[4] == "BIBLE.md"
)
def _git_network_bounded(
args: List[str], *, timeout: Optional[float] = None
) -> Tuple[int, str, str]:
"""Run one non-interactive git network command under the shared ceiling."""
from ouroboros.platform_layer import kill_process_tree, subprocess_new_group_kwargs
from ouroboros.tools.shell import _active_subprocesses, _subprocess_lock
from ouroboros.update_channels import get_managed_update_fetch_timeout_sec
from supervisor import git_ops as _g
limit = float(timeout or get_managed_update_fetch_timeout_sec())
env = {**os.environ, "LC_ALL": "C", "LANG": "C", "GIT_TERMINAL_PROMPT": "0"}
try:
proc = subprocess.Popen(
["git", "-c", "http.lowSpeedLimit=1024", "-c", "http.lowSpeedTime=30", *args],
cwd=str(_g.REPO_DIR),
stdout=subprocess.PIPE,
stderr=subprocess.PIPE,
text=True,
env=env,
**subprocess_new_group_kwargs(),
)
except OSError as exc:
return 127, "", str(exc)
with _subprocess_lock:
_active_subprocesses.add(proc)
try:
try:
out, err = proc.communicate(timeout=limit)
except subprocess.TimeoutExpired:
kill_process_tree(proc)
try:
proc.communicate(timeout=10)
except Exception:
pass
return FETCH_TIMEOUT_RC, "", (
f"git {' '.join(args[:2])} exceeded {limit:.0f}s and was terminated"
)
return proc.returncode, (out or "").strip(), (err or "").strip()
finally:
with _subprocess_lock:
_active_subprocesses.discard(proc)
def git_fetch_bounded(remote_name: str, *, timeout: Optional[float] = None) -> Tuple[int, str, str]:
"""Fetch the official remote under one cross-platform wall-clock ceiling."""
return _git_network_bounded(
[
"fetch",
"--quiet",
remote_name,
f"+refs/heads/*:refs/remotes/{remote_name}/*",
f"+refs/tags/*:{MANAGED_TAG_NAMESPACE}/*",
],
timeout=timeout,
)
def _managed_update_target() -> Tuple[str, str, str]:
"""Return the runtime-selected official ref, independent from launcher provenance."""
from supervisor import git_ops as _g
managed_meta = _g._read_managed_repo_meta()
if not managed_meta:
return "", "", ""
from ouroboros.update_channels import get_update_branch
remote_name = _g._managed_remote_name(managed_meta)
remote_branch = get_update_branch()
target_ref = f"{remote_name}/{remote_branch}" if remote_name and remote_branch else ""
return remote_name, remote_branch, target_ref
def resolve_managed_update_target(
remote_name: str,
remote_branch: str,
branch_ref: str,
*,
update_channel: str,
capture: Callable[[List[str]], Tuple[int, str, str]],
) -> Tuple[str, str, str]:
"""Resolve the selected feed to one immutable commit.
QA and Development follow their branch tips. Stable follows the newest plain
``vX.Y.Z`` release whose commit is reachable from both ``main`` and
``ouroboros-stable``. This keeps an untagged main commit out of the stable
feed without creating a second channel-specific updater.
"""
if not remote_name or not remote_branch or not branch_ref:
return "", "", "managed update target is unavailable"
if str(update_channel or "") != "stable":
rc, sha, error = capture(
["git", "rev-parse", "--verify", f"{branch_ref}^{{commit}}"]
)
return (branch_ref, sha, "") if rc == 0 and sha else ("", "", error or branch_ref)
main_ref = f"{remote_name}/main"
qa_ref = f"{remote_name}/ouroboros-stable"
for required_ref in (main_ref, qa_ref):
rc, _sha, error = capture(
["git", "rev-parse", "--verify", f"{required_ref}^{{commit}}"]
)
if rc != 0:
return "", "", error or f"stable release branch is unavailable: {required_ref}"
rc, raw_tags, error = capture(
[
"git",
"for-each-ref",
"--format=%(refname:strip=3)",
f"{MANAGED_TAG_NAMESPACE}/v*",
]
)
if rc != 0:
return "", "", error or "could not list release tags"
candidates = []
for tag in raw_tags.splitlines():
match = _RELEASE_TAG_RE.fullmatch(tag.strip())
if match:
candidates.append((tuple(int(part) for part in match.groups()), tag.strip()))
candidates.sort(reverse=True)
for _version, tag in candidates:
tag_ref = f"{MANAGED_TAG_NAMESPACE}/{tag}"
rc, sha, _error = capture(
["git", "rev-parse", "--verify", f"{tag_ref}^{{commit}}"]
)
if rc != 0 or not sha:
continue
present_in_both = True
for release_branch_ref in (main_ref, qa_ref):
ancestor_rc, _out, _ancestor_error = capture(
["git", "merge-base", "--is-ancestor", sha, release_branch_ref]
)
if ancestor_rc != 0:
present_in_both = False
break
if present_in_both:
return tag_ref, sha, ""
return "", "", "no shared stable vX.Y.Z release exists on main and ouroboros-stable"
